Beginning in 1977 the SeaBus has served passengers travelling from North Vancouver to Vancouver. This passenger-only service replaced another Burrard Inlet passenger-only ferry service that ran from 1900 until 1958.

Today the SeaBus has currently four vessels in operation. The first two - The Burrard Beaver and the Burrard Otter - have been in service since opening day on June 17, 1977. All four vessels have a capacity of 385 passengers.

The SeaBus is owned and operated by TransLink, a local transit authority. As such passengers can transfer to buses and trains on a single fare whisking them throughout Metro Vancouver.
